Cost of Exit Window Installation typ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,500 depending on window size and complexity. Larger or custom-sized windows tend to be at the higher end of the spectrum.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.
Labor and Materials Expenses usually account for a significant portion of the total cost, with labor costs around $500 to $1,500. Material costs vary based on window type, such as vinyl or wood, which can influence overall expenses. Contact local service providers for precise pricing tailored to your project.
Additional Costs to Consider may include permits, which can range from $50 to $300, and potential structural modifications. These factors can impact the total project cost and should be discussed with local contractors. Budgeting for unexpected expenses is advisable when planning an exit window installation.
Average Cost Range for professional installation services in Marietta, GA, is approximately $1,500 to $4,000. Prices vary based on window specifications, site conditions, and contractor rates. Local pros can help determine the most accurate cost estimate for your specific needs.

What is an exit window? An exit window is a window designed to provide a safe egress point from a building, typically required in basements and bedrooms for emergency escape.
Are there specific size requirements for exit windows? Yes, local building codes usually specify minimum size and opening dimensions to ensure safe escape and rescue.
Can existing windows be converted into exit windows? In some cases, existing windows can be modified to meet exit requirements, but professional assessment is recommended.
What types of windows are suitable for exit installation? Common options include casement, sliding, and egress windows, which can be installed to meet safety standards.
